ROCHESTER, N.Y. – 16 people are without a home and 10 people are in the hospital after two fires broke out Tuesday afternoon in Rochester. Eight of those injured are firefighters.

The Rochester Fire Department says three of their firefighters sustained 1st and 2nd degree burns battling a four-alarm fire at a townhome on Dewey Avenue just after noon.

“Right now, I have three firefighter injuries and two civilian injuries,” said Chief Stefano Napolitano at the scene on Dewey Ave. “The firefighter injuries appear to be burns in nature. The civilian injuries happen to be more atmospheric conditions,” he said, referring to the heat and humidity.

Less than 30 minutes after getting the fire under control on Dewey Ave., RFD responded to a call on West Ave. at the Flower City Art Noire Collective, a summer art camp.

“This hasn’t been my year,” said Tonya Noel Stevens, co-owner of the art camp. “It’s been a rough time already. I really hope the community can come out and really turn out, support us to help us move forward in this. I’m so grateful that camp was canceled today. We were literally supposed to be having camp right now.”

On top of the damage, five other firefighters were taken to the hospital for minor injuries including burns, heat stress and two falls. RFD says a lot of those heat-related injuries come from Tuesday’s high heat and humidity.

“So what we’ll do is we’ll bring in additional resources to cover those firefighters, as well as covering the firefighters that really need to be a couple of hours of rehabilitation, to cool down and get their strength back,” said Chief Napolitano at the West Avenue scene. “It depends on what the level of heat exhaustion is. It’ll be determined by a medical provider that will tell us they need other cleared to return to work.”

Four refugee families were displaced by the fire on Dewey Avenue, one of them from the Congo. The Red Cross is helping them find a temporary place to regroup and rest.
